How Redbrick Achieved $20 Million Revenue with Strategic Growth Tactics

In the competitive technology landscape, few companies have managed to achieve rapid growth as successfully as Redbrick. As the second fastest-growing software company in Canada, Redbrick has made significant strides in revenue growth, expanding from a modest $200,000 in revenue in 2010 to an impressive $10 to $20 million by 2015, according to CEO Tobin Sowden. This remarkable journey is a testament to the strategic decisions and innovative tactics employed by the company. In this blog post, we will dive deep into the strategies that propelled Redbrick to such heights, drawing insights from an exclusive interview with Tobin Sowden and other data sources. 2010: Launched with $200k Revenue Using Software Distribution Redbrick's story begins in 2010, when the company was launched with a focus on software distribution. According to Tobin Sowden, the initial business model was centered around helping other developers acquire users for their products through performance-based deals, such as cost-per-install or revenue sharing.
